The Early Days of Jacksepticeye
Jacksepticeye, whose real name is Sean McLoughlin, first gained fame on YouTube in 2012. Initially, he created content around his gaming experiences, but soon shifted his focus to vlogging and commentary. His unique personality, energetic commentary, and infectious enthusiasm quickly gained him a massive following. He became known for his high-energy commentary, often incorporating humor and pop culture references into his videos. As his channel grew, so did his popularity, and he eventually became one of the most recognizable and beloved YouTubers in the world.
